Output dd230256ad7187a0b4e1df36df7cf4ff4239b25102950d9a76fb6d022cc803d8:15

value
10412223
script pubkey
OP_0 OP_PUSHBYTES_20 dabd76ae617056f72f6ea2bf175c9ad19f90c2a6
address
bc1qm27hdtnpwpt0wtmw52l3why66x0eps4xhq4zlk
transaction
dd230256ad7187a0b4e1df36df7cf4ff4239b25102950d9a76fb6d022cc803d8
spent
true